TACT Manual Remains Vital for Global Air Cargo Industry Amid E-Commerce Boom

This article presents the important air freight rate manual TACT (The Air Cargo Tariff), first published in 1975 and currently co-published by several airlines. TACT is divided into three main parts and includes all rules and detailed rate information for international transport. Understanding how to use TACT enables transportation professionals to obtain precise quotes, thereby enhancing decision-making efficiency and market competitiveness.

Boeing Predicts Global Air Cargo Traffic to Double by 2043 Amid Asian Growth

Boeing forecasts that global air cargo traffic will double by 2043, with an average annual growth of 4%, driven primarily by the Asian market. The report highlights e-commerce, supply chain reshaping, and emerging market demand as key growth factors. Airlines should focus on the Asian market, optimize operations, and address challenges to capitalize on the opportunities. Global Air Freight Rates Climb Amid Tariff Challenges

Despite tariff pressures, international air cargo rates remain strong. Recent data shows a global increase in air freight costs, particularly on outbound routes from China. Cancellations of e-commerce flights and holiday impacts have caused fluctuations in cargo volumes, but the market remains generally stable. Businesses must seize opportunities to address challenges.

North American Class 8 Truck Orders Rise As Supply Chains Improve

North American Class 8 heavy-duty truck orders rebounded strongly in December, indicating easing supply chain pressures and robust market demand. However, production capacity bottlenecks remain a key constraint on industry development.
